| Error / Exception | HTTP | Cause | Fix |
|-------------------|------|-------|-----|
| DuplicateEntryError | 409 | Unique constraint violation on insert/rename | Check existence first OR catch and return existing |
| DoesNotExistError | 404 | get_doc() on missing record | Use frappe.db.exists() first OR catch exception |
| LinkValidationError | 417 | Link field points to non-existent record | Validate link target exists before save |
| LinkExistsError | N/A | Delete blocked by linked documents | Show linked docs to user; use force=True carefully |
| MandatoryError | 417 | Required field is empty on save | Set all mandatory fields before insert/save |
| TimestampMismatchError | N/A | Concurrent edit detected (modified changed) | Reload doc and retry, or inform user to refresh |
| CharacterLengthExceededError | 417 | String exceeds field maxlength / DB column size | Truncate input or increase field length |
| DataTooLongException | 417 | Value exceeds DB column storage capacity | Same as CharacterLengthExceededError |
| InReadOnlyMode | 503 | Write attempted during read-only mode | Check frappe.flags.in_import or site config |
| QueryTimeoutError | N/A | Query exceeded time limit [v15+] | Add indexes, reduce result set, paginate |
| QueryDeadlockError | N/A | Two transactions waiting on each other | Retry with backoff; reduce transaction scope |
| TooManyWritesError | N/A | Excessive writes in single request | Batch operations; use background jobs |
| InternalError (gone away) | N/A | MariaDB connection dropped | Reconnect with frappe.db.connect() |
| InternalError (too many) | N/A | Connection pool exhausted | Check max_connections; close idle connections |
| ValidationError | 417 | General validation failure in save | Read error message; fix field values |
| SQL syntax error | N/A | Wrong frappe.db.sql() parameter format | Use %(name)s with dict, NOT %s with tuple |

# ❌ WRONG — %s with positional tuple (works but fragile)
frappe.db.sql("SELECT * FROM `tabItem` WHERE name = %s", ("ITEM-001",))
# ❌ WRONG — f-string or .format() — SQL INJECTION!
frappe.db.sql(f"SELECT * FROM `tabItem` WHERE name = '{item_name}'")
frappe.db.sql("SELECT * FROM `tabItem` WHERE name = '{}'".format(item_name))
# ❌ WRONG — bare % operator
frappe.db.sql("SELECT * FROM `tabItem` WHERE name = '%s'" % item_name)
# ✅ CORRECT — named parameters with dict (ALWAYS use this)
frappe.db.sql(
"SELECT * FROM `tabItem` WHERE name = %(name)s AND warehouse = %(wh)s",
{"name": item_name, "wh": warehouse},
as_dict=True
)
# ✅ CORRECT — frappe.qb (query builder, no injection risk)
Item = frappe.qb.DocType("Item")
result = (
frappe.qb.from_(Item)
.select(Item.name, Item.item_name)
.where(Item.warehouse == warehouse)
.run(as_dict=True)
)
Rule: ALWAYS use %(name)s with a dict parameter. NEVER use string formatting for SQL values.
# ❌ DANGEROUS — get_value returns None, not raises
credit = frappe.db.get_value("Customer", "CUST-001", "credit_limit")
if credit > 1000: # TypeError: '>' not supported between NoneType and int
pass
# ✅ CORRECT — handle None explicitly
credit = frappe.db.get_value("Customer", "CUST-001", "credit_limit")
if credit is None:
frappe.throw(_("Customer not found"))
credit = credit or 0 # Default to 0 if field is empty
# ✅ CORRECT — get_value with as_dict for multiple fields
data = frappe.db.get_value("Customer", "CUST-001",
["credit_limit", "disabled"], as_dict=True)
if not data: # None when record not found
frappe.throw(_("Customer not found"))
if data.disabled:
frappe.throw(_("Customer is disabled"))
Key behavior by method:
| Method | Record Not Found | Empty Field |
|--------|-----------------|-------------|
| get_doc() | Raises DoesNotExistError | Returns field default |
| get_value() | Returns None | Returns None or "" |
| get_all() | Returns [] | Included in result |
| exists() | Returns False | N/A |
| set_value() | Silently does nothing | N/A |
| db.sql() | Returns [] or () | Included in result |

# ❌ CAUSES DEADLOCKS — long transaction with many writes
def process_all():
for inv in frappe.get_all("Sales Invoice", limit=10000):
doc = frappe.get_doc("Sales Invoice", inv.name)
doc.custom_field = "value"
doc.save() # Each save locks rows; other processes wait
# ✅ CORRECT — batch with commits to release locks
def process_all():
invoices = frappe.get_all("Sales Invoice", limit=10000)
BATCH = 100
for i in range(0, len(invoices), BATCH):
for inv in invoices[i:i + BATCH]:
frappe.db.set_value("Sales Invoice", inv.name, "custom_field", "value")
frappe.db.commit() # Release locks after each batch
# ✅ CORRECT — retry on deadlock
import time
def with_deadlock_retry(func, max_retries=3):
for attempt in range(max_retries):
try:
return func()
except frappe.QueryDeadlockError:
if attempt < max_retries - 1:
frappe.db.rollback()
time.sleep(0.5 * (attempt + 1))
else:
raise
# Pattern: Connection recovery
def reliable_operation():
try:
return frappe.db.sql("SELECT 1")
except frappe.db.InternalError as e:
msg = str(e).lower()
if "gone away" in msg or "lost connection" in msg:
frappe.db.connect() # Reconnect
return frappe.db.sql("SELECT 1")
if "too many connections" in msg:
frappe.log_error("Too many DB connections", "Connection Pool")
frappe.throw(_("Server busy. Please try again in a moment."))
raise # Unknown InternalError — re-raise

|---------|:------------:|:--------------:|
| Web request (POST/PUT) | YES | NEVER |
| Controller hooks (validate, on_update) | YES | NEVER |
| doc_events hooks | YES | NEVER |
| Scheduler tasks | NO | ALWAYS |
| Background jobs (frappe.enqueue) | NO | ALWAYS |
| bench execute | NO | ALWAYS |

# ❌ INJECTION VULNERABLE — all of these
frappe.db.sql(f"SELECT * FROM `tabItem` WHERE name = '{user_input}'")
frappe.db.sql("SELECT * FROM `tabItem` WHERE name = '%s'" % user_input)
frappe.db.sql("SELECT * FROM `tabItem` WHERE name = '{}'".format(user_input))
# ❌ ALSO VULNERABLE — in permission_query_conditions
def query_conditions(user):
return f"owner = '{user}'" # Unescaped!
# ✅ SAFE — parameterized query
frappe.db.sql("SELECT * FROM `tabItem` WHERE name = %(name)s", {"name": user_input})
# ✅ SAFE — frappe.db.escape() for dynamic SQL (permission hooks)
def query_conditions(user):
return f"owner = {frappe.db.escape(user)}"
# ✅ SAFE — query builder
Item = frappe.qb.DocType("Item")
frappe.qb.from_(Item).where(Item.name == user_input).run()
# ✅ SAFE — ORM methods
frappe.get_all("Item", filters={"name": user_input})
frappe.db.get_value("Item", user_input, "item_name")
# ❌ DANGEROUS — no error if record doesn't exist
frappe.db.set_value("Customer", "NONEXISTENT", "status", "Active")
# Returns without error! No rows updated.
# ✅ ALWAYS verify existence before set_value
if not frappe.db.exists("Customer", customer_name):
frappe.throw(_("Customer '{0}' not found").format(customer_name))
frappe.db.set_value("Customer", customer_name, "status", "Active")
# Note: set_value skips validate/on_update hooks
# Use doc.save() when you need validation to run
